What they do
A Physical Therapy Assistant assists physical therapists to help patients with disabling injuries or conditions improve their range of motion and manage their pain. Helps patients learn exercises and teaches them to use therapeutic equipment. Works in the office of a physical therapist or in a healthcare facility.

Mary Free Bed is a not-for-profit, nationally accredited rehabilitation hospital serving thousands of children and adults each year through inpatient, outpatient, sub-acute rehabilitation, orthotics and prosthetics and home and community programs. With the most comprehensive rehabilitation services in Michigan and an exclusive focus on rehabilitation, Mary Free Bed physicians, nurses and therapists help our patients achieve outstanding clinical outcomes.

Age Specific Responsibility Must be able todemonstratethe knowledge and skills necessary to provide careappropriate tothe age of the patients served in assigned department. Must demonstrate knowledge of the principles of growth and development over the life span and possess the ability to assess data reflective of the patient's status and interpret the appropriate informationneeded to identify each patient's requirements relative to age-specific needs and to provide the care needed as described in the department's policies and procedures. Summary Provides physical therapy services as assigned by, and under the supervisionof,a physical therapist.
Keeps treatment skills updated through continuing education, evidence-based research, and program development. Perform job responsibilitiesin accordance withthe program's strategicobjectivesand goals to carry out organizational strategicobjectives. Essential Job Responsibilities Staff will provide patient care, treatment, and services within the scope of their license, certification or registration and as required by law and regulation. Each job responsibility is related to the MFB Pillars of Excellence. The responsibility isidentifiedto a pillar by the following letters: Q (Quality), S (Service), P (People), G (Growth), F (Financial). Staff will provide patient care, treatment, and services within the scope of their license, certification or registration and as required by law and regulation. Provides patient care.(Q) Assiststhe physical therapist in treatment planning and conducting evaluation procedures. Assiststhe physical therapist in treating patientsutilizingmodalities, therapeutic exercise, assistive devices, and functional activities. Provides verbal and/or written feedback to the physical therapistregardingall significant observations or changes in the patient's condition, reaction, and response to treatment.
